Description

Indenture of fine made in the court of Dame Agnes de Hastynges, countess of Pembroke, lady of Bergeveny, and warden, by the king's grant, of the county of Pembroke, during the minority of John, son and heir of Laurence de Hastynges, before John Wyse, steward and sheriff of Pembroke, and others (named), between John Wise the elder, and Joan his wife, plaintiffs, and John Hendyman and Philip Broun, chaplains, deforciants, of three messuages and land in Castelton, a messuage and land and a moiety of a water-mill in Kylkemorran, a messuage and land in. . . . ton, a messuage and land in Athelardeslond, land in Ser. . khill, a messuage, land, and a water-mill in Henthlan, land in Porttraghan, a messuage and land in Ridebard, and the lordship and service of messuages and lands in Castelton', le Brigge', and Morston:Pembrokeshire Tuesday after the Assumption, 37 Edw III
